Men's Dress Shirt Fabric
The education of fabrics is an involved one and an important one to be sure but I want to talk here about emotion. Feel the fabric. Let the shirt fabric fall over your hand and arm. It's that easy. Quality fabrics feel soft, supple and hang in a relaxed manner.
This is vital for the dress shirt to feel good on your body. So choose a dress shirt fabric you really like. Period. A beautiful densely-woven Egyptian cotton can feel luxurious to some, while a classic Pima cotton sets off that feel-good response in others.
The point is to purchase a dress shirt that will be comfortable and move with you. The longer, smoother fibers of a quality fabric next to your body all day is a joy, boosting you to the next level of comfort and attitude.
Here are a few words about the solid vs. print debate. Solid color dress shirts are the safe classic. You simply can't go wrong with a solid color and is definitely the best choice if your wardrobe dollars are limited.
Prints can be printed on or woven into the fabric. The higher the quality, the more likely it is the fabric has a woven-in design. In a woven design, the yarns are dyed prior to weaving, then the computerized looms make the pattern. Woven designs are richer, more textural and luxurious.
Choosing Quality Style Elements Of The Man's Dress Shirt
Let's first talk about cuffs. And just to be clear, dress shirts always have long sleeves. So there's the classic button cuff which will get you through most of your life. A quality dress shirt cuff will be free from wrinkles or folds and have straight topstitching. The vent will be generous and may have another little button.
French cuffs may say more about style than about quality. French cuffs are great, don't get me wrong, and they can make an elegant statement with an heirloom pair of cufflinks, but they are not the deciding factor in terms of quality.
So when shopping for a dress shirt, you will find high-quality with both Button Cuffs and French Cuffs. Collars dictate style as well. Click here to read more about collar styles.
In terms of quality, the collar should always fold over in a relaxed and natural fashion – never forced or with diagonal wrinkles. In the construction process, collars must be cut and sewn with finesse to be successful and a quality tailor will see to it that this crucial part of a dress shirt is done right. Crooked, off-kilter collars cannot be pressed straight. They will always be wrong.
